The C9 was the result of a venture between Mercedes-Benz and and car designer Peter Sauber, with 900hp engines being installed in the Sauber-designed bodies. Capable of nearly 400kph (close to 250mph), the C9 competed in a number of 1987 races as the fastest car, and recorded the fastest lap at Le Mans that year. Revell's kit of the C9 features authentic detailing inside and out, including a multi-part rear wing with "filigree" supports. Decals are included to model the two "sports car races" and the Le Mans race (1987 season). Measures 19.9cm when complete.
